This book presents a systematic treatment of Henstock–Orlicz (or H-Orlicz) spaces with minimal assumptions on the Young function. H-Orlicz spaces contain non-absolute integrable functions called Henstock–Kurzweil integrable functions. Results from classical functional analysis are presented in detail, and new material is included on classical analysis. Extrapolation is used to prove, for example, the countable additivity of Henstock–Dunford integrable functions on H-Orlicz spaces are included. Relationships of modular convergence and norm convergence of H-Orlicz spaces are discussed. Finally, central geometrical results are provided for H-spaces, including uniformly convexity, reflexivity and the Radon–Nikodym property of the H–Orlicz spaces. Primarily aimed at researchers and PhD students interested in Orlicz spaces or generalized Orlicz spaces, this book can be used as a basis for advanced graduate courses in analysis.

Bipan Hazarika is a Professor of Department of Mathematics, Gauhati University, Guwahati, Assam. Earlier, he worked at Rajiv Gandhi University, Arunachal Pradesh, India from 2005 to 2017. He was Professor at Rajiv Gandhi University up to 2017. He received an M.Sc. and Ph.D. from Gauhati University, Guwahati, India. His main research areas are sequences spaces, summability theory, applications of fixed point theory and measure of noncompactness, fuzzy analysis, and non-absolute integrable function spaces. He published more than 200 research articles in several renowned international journals. He is a regular reviewer of more than 50 different journals published by Springer, Elsevier, Taylor and Francis, Wiley, IOS Press, World Scientific, American Mathematical Society, IEEE, De Gruyter, etc. He published books on Differential Equations, Differential Calculus and Integral Calculus. He published a monograph “Non-Newtonian Sequence Spaces with Applications” in Chapman and Hall/CRC press. Recently he edited following books: "Sequence Spaces Theory and Applications, “Advances in Mathematics Analysis and its Applications”, “Dynamic Equations on Time Scales and Applications”, Chapman and Hall/CRC press, "Fixed Point Theory and Fractional Calculus: Recent Advances and Applications”, “Approximation Theory, Sequence Spaces and Applications”, “Advances in Topology, Dynamical Systems, and  Interdisciplinary Applications” Springer, and “Generalized Integral and Applications” World Scientific. He is an editorial board member of more than 10 international journals and guest editor of a special issue named "Sequence spaces, Function spaces and Approximation Theory" of Journal of Function Spaces, Special Issue on “International Conference of Nonlinear Analysis and Applications (ICNAA-2022)” of Journal of Nonlinear and Convex Analysis, “Advances in Nonlinear Functional Analysis on Fractional Differential Equations”,  Fractal and Fractional,  MDPI, “Symmetry in Fixed Point Theory and Applications”, Symmetry, MDPI. In 2022, 2023 and 2024 he was listed among the world’s top 2% Scientists by Stanford University.

Hemanta Kalita is Assistant Professor, Mathematics Division, VIT Bhopal University, Kothri Kalan, Bhopal-Indore Highway, Sehore, Madhya Pradesh, India. A PhD from Gauhati University under the guidance of Prof. Bipan Hazarika, he has an academic experience of 12 years and has worked in various capacity. With more than 35 research papers in peer-reviewed international journals and 2 papers in international conferences held in India and abroad, he has organized the International Conference (ICNAA-2022) at Assam Don Bosco University, and the International Conference on Nonlinear Analysis and Computational Techniques (ICNACT-2024) at VIT Bhopal University. An invited speaker at Usak University, Turkey, he has edited two issues of the as a Guest Editor, in 2023 and 2024. Presently, he is handling several special issues of many reputed journals, such as , , and to name a few. On the editorial board of a few international journals, his primary research areas are in sequence spaces, summability theory, fixed point theory, fuzzy analysis and function spaces of non-absolute integrable functions. He has research collaborators in several countries of Europe, USA, Asian and Africa.
